T-Mobile US Inc. 5.500% Senior Notes due March 2070 (TMUSZ) represent fixed income securities issued by T-Mobile US, Inc. Unlike common equity, these senior notes do not generate traditional earnings per share (EPS) metrics. Instead, investors in these notes receive periodic coupon payments at a fixed rate of 5.500% annually and return of principal at maturity in March 2070.
